Badminton News: India’s number one badminton player Lakshya Sen, his family and former national coach Vimal Kumar have been charged with age fraud and cheating in an FIR filed in Bengaluru.

The FIR, filed Thursday by Ms Goviappa Nagaraja, alleges the 21-year-old defending Commonwealth Games champion, along with his brother Chirag Sen, falsified their ages to compete in age-group tournaments since 2010.

The complaint, a copy of which is in the possession of PTI, also mentions Sports Authority of India coach father Sen Dhirendra, mothers Nirmala and Kumar, who have coached the pair for over 10 years.

They were charged with fraud (Section 420), forgery (468), using false documents as genuine (471) and acts committed by several persons with the same intent (34) under the Indian Penal Code.

The Sen brothers, who hail from Uttarakhand, train under Kumar at the Prakash Padukone Badminton Academy in Bengaluru, while the reporter runs another academy in the metropolis.

The whistleblower accuses Kumar of colluding with Lakshya’s parents to falsify his birth certificate in 2010. If the allegations are true, the Indian star, who recently received the Arjuna award, will have to give up several of his folders.

Firmly denying the allegations, Kumar told PTI: “It is very upsetting. It’s cheap stuff. Lakshya Sen did well and resumed training after the break. It’s very mentally disturbing. »

Currently on No. Wednesday, World No. 6 Lakshya Sen received the Arjuna Award at Rashtrapati Bhavan. He won bronze at the World Championships after losing to fellow countryman Kidambi Srikanth in 2021.

He was also an English Championship runner-up and played a key role in India’s historic Thomas Cup victory earlier this year.

Prakash Padukone Badminton Academy head coach Kumar further said in a statement that the accusations were “baseless, reckless and made with malicious intent”.

“As all badminton lovers know, age verification is the sole prerogative and responsibility of the Badminton Association of India, which is the sole governing authority to administer the game in India,” he said.

“All players, regardless of where they train, represent their respective state unit or affiliate country when participating in a national or international tournament.”

“My goal in my 30 years as a coach has always been to prepare our promising youngsters to the best of my ability to bring victory to our country based on their achievements. Therefore, I deny all these false accusations against me. I don’t want to comment further on that,” he added.

According to the complaint, Lakshya Sen is 24 years old, while his date of birth (August 16, 2001) registered with the Badminton Association of India makes him three years younger.

His older brother Chirag, meanwhile, is said to be 26 years old, although his BAI identity card lists him as 24 (22 July 1998).

According to the complaint, Lakshya Sen barred some children from accessing quality badminton facilities and sponsorship by participating in several tournaments in the age group category.

The plaintiffs further alleged that their families and the coach harmed many talented and promising players in the region and demanded legal action against the five.

Lakshya and his family have yet to comment on the matter.
